A lot of schools require health-type classes. I know the schools in GA do. I can understand credit for sports participation counting for the health classes. Would like to read the whole story.. couldn't find it on cbs.sportsline.com. What is HPS 1040-Health? HPS 1040, Health Concepts & Strategies, is a 2 hour credit course which satisfies the core health education requirement for graduation. The class consists of a one-hour lecture and meets twice per week. In addition, the instructors often use Web CT to supplement course material with additional relevant information and activities designed to reinforce lecture material. Course content focuses on the critical analysis of health information, the development of strategies to promote good health, and assumption of personal responsibility for health enhancement. -
